问题是:
  一次想引入多个文件,包括自定义引入文件列表,自定义引入文件类型。
以下是一般逻辑思维代码:
function include_some_cache($path, $filelist=array(), $filetype=array('php')){
if(!is_dir($path)){
return false;
}
if(is_array($filetype)){
foreach($filetype as $ft){
if(is_array($ft)){
include_some_cache($path,$filelist,$ft);
}else{
if(is_array($filelist)){
foreach($filelist as $fn){
if(is_array($fn)){
include_some_cache($path,$fn,$ft);
}else{
include_cache($path.$fn.'.'.$ft);
}
}
}else{
include_cache($path.$filelist.'.'.$ft);
}
}
}
}else{
if(is_array($filelist)){
foreach($filelist as $fn){
if(is_array($fn)){
include_some_cache($path,$fn,$filetype);
}else{
include_cache($path.$fn.'.'.$filetype);
}
}
}else{
include_cache($path.$filelist.'.'.$filetype);
}
}
}PS:include_cache--引入单文件函数。
  发此目的只为寻求最优代码,最优逻辑结构,这是一个匠才所应具备的,希望回贴者只跟出代码,无需废言...  ---------
           期待您给给出最完美解决方案!